Size: a a a

ESP8266 & ESP32 [RU]

2021 September 08

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
Телеграм бот
источник

🤙Ꮶ

🤙🏻 ℙ𝔸𝕍𝔼𝕃 ᏦᎾᏢᏦᎾᏉ... in ESP8266 & ESP32 [RU]
Ну это надо поднимать "сервер" на микрухе, лонг поллинг как бы ...
источник

🤙Ꮶ

🤙🏻 ℙ𝔸𝕍𝔼𝕃 ᏦᎾᏢᏦᎾᏉ... in ESP8266 & ESP32 [RU]
если по запросу данные нужны
источник

🤙Ꮶ

🤙🏻 ℙ𝔸𝕍𝔼𝕃 ᏦᎾᏢᏦᎾᏉ... in ESP8266 & ESP32 [RU]
Но да, не нужен ip, но чем тогда это лучше mqtt ?)))
источник

VV

Vladimir V. in ESP8266 & ESP32 [RU]
ha.islife.ru добавляли датчик esp32+mpu6050+mqtt и использовали сборку tasmota. Были ошибки и постоянно был переконнект к  home assistant. Нп прошлой неделе испрпвили баг.
источник

VV

Vladimir V. in ESP8266 & ESP32 [RU]
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
ПАМАГИТЕ !
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
что не так со String ? или это я дурак?
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
https://stackoverflow.com/questions/56779459/why-do-i-get-the-debug-exception-reason-stack-canary-watchpoint-triggered-main
Такое ощущение, что стека на всё не хватает.
Может, loop слишком длинный и с кучей локальных переменных?
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
да, охрененно длинный с охрененной кучей локальных переменных. 😂 видимо я слишком много хочу от esp32.
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
Ну вот просто куча локальных переменных (ещё и толстых, наверное), не влезают в стек
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
Наверное, можно как-то увеличить размер стека задачи, в которой крутится loop
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
А ещё можно не хранить на стеке ничего толстого
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
определить глобальными?
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
Да
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
спсб, буду че нибудь придумывать.
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
Только у глобальных переменных конструктор вызывается ещё до старта RTOS. Обычно это не проблема, но я на всякий случай предупредил.
источник

‌W

‌‌‎👿 Daemonic Wisp... in ESP8266 & ESP32 [RU]
Есть ещё вариант динамически выделять память - но это не то, чем стоит заниматься в loop.
источник

SZ

Slava Zagaynov in ESP8266 & ESP32 [RU]
побыстрому местами исправил - заработало, спсб за поддержку.
источник
2021 September 09

.

. in ESP8266 & ESP32 [RU]
Плата esp-12 пришла, дрова поставил вручную, так как винда автоматически их не установила - в итоге всё равно не работает. Её комп не распознаёт.
Потом понял, что поставил дрова на ch340, а у меня cp2102, поменял - тоже не работает.
Решил воспользоваться советом овербафера, через программу по обновлению драйверов чекнуть, но прога говорит, что дрова самой последней версии. Как быть?
источник